Pros

There are no benefits other than being employed.

Cons

There's literally no benefits to working here other than having a job. They don't even cover your personal health insurance. Just a small percentage. If you have a family you'd be better off on welfare. Luckily my partner has health coverage or I'd be better off working at McDonald's after the premiums. I've sold cars at a few dealerships and this is the worst. They actually cut your pay when you're doing good. They stopped our unused vacation from rolling over and stopped cash outs not long ago. And recently they stopped using our average hourly pay and switched to a lower flat rate for everyone. Even if you're the top sales person you get paid the same hourly rate as the worse salesperson. They also cut our commission plan and blamed it on covid even though profit has been through the roof according to my managers. Dont waste your time applying here. You won't be appreciated no matter how hard you work or how productive you are. There's a reason why no managers or salespeople stay long term. They preach family and Aloha but there is none. That's why they have to keep hiring people from the mainland. It's a small island and everyone knows JN is the worst dealer group to work for. I heard JN was way better when the father ran things.
